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Crossbreeding is a widely established management practice among commercial pork producers. Over the years, the industry has used rotational crossbreeding programs extensively. Rotational programs are relatively easy to operate, enable pork producers to develop their own females, and exploit most of the possible heterosis.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: More than 90 percent of hogs marketed are of mixed breeding, an indication that crossbreeding is a well accepted management program. Yet crossbreeding alone does not guarantee efficient, profitable production. Choosing the system and breeds that fit your management and environment and operating the system correctly should result in profitable production.
